/*
 * Sandbox client for user-supplied formulas (Tallygrove release 4.2).
 * All formulas run inside the Crucible evaluator with no filesystem
 * or network access; only whitelisted math builtins are exposed.
 * Release manager: verify the sandbox policy version before signing off.
 * The client authenticates to the internal Crucible API with the key below.
 */

gateway credential: kto23_LX9A4ys6i4nzHtpOLNLodKK

## Break-Glass: Publishing a Brindleworks UI Hotfix

If the Brindleworks component library needs an emergency version bump and normal release owners are unreachable, break-glass lets you publish a patch release directly. Use it sparingly — every use pings the security channel. The publish gate will stop you once and ask for the phrase below.

vault phrase of yagag-kadup = belael-druius-rusax-kelox

## Further Reading

The flaky DNS resolution issue affecting the Harrowgate build fleet stems from a race between the resolver cache refresh and the overlay network's lease renewal. Symptoms include intermittent NXDOMAIN responses for internal service names, typically during the first five minutes after a node reboot. A workaround (pinning the resolver to the secondary endpoint) is in place, but release managers should confirm the permanent fix ships in cycle 9. The full investigation notes are published here.

runbook for tafof-yawif: https://confluence.tolvaqsys.internal/display/display/browse/pages/7be3

**Runbook: Calendar sync conflict (Slatewing)**

Symptom: duplicate events after a two-way sync between Slatewing and the partner feed. Cause: conflict resolver prefers remote timestamps, so locally edited events get re-created. Fix is in the merge branch — reviewer, check the dedupe key includes the recurrence ID, not just the event UID. Verified against the build below.

session token of tajef-bageg = htk21_5d90d574934f3ccae6437